Output 25b529a55005eb1c866c5fadb4bc5a71d1c63ad66b9fac4b665561fa16363c9a:9

value
1329386501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1ebe5fcb65b3e8298546b2a6c1cff19914d1641 OP_EQUAL
address
3GTBJwE7NKjJF1mKjku2aL691q445WxQkH
transaction
25b529a55005eb1c866c5fadb4bc5a71d1c63ad66b9fac4b665561fa16363c9a
confirmations
411138
spent
true